Eurasian Integration: The History
• Agreement on Commonwealth of Independent States (CIS) –
Dec, 1991
• Treaty on Increased Economic Integration, 1996
• Agreement on Customs Union and Single Economic Space,
1999
• Treaty on Eurasian economic community, 2000
• Adoption of Customs Code and application of unique
external tariff, 2010
• Agreement on lifting internal border controls, July, 2012
• Agreement on Eurasian Union, 2011
• Establishment of Customs Union , Jan, 2010
• Establishment of Single Economic Space, Jan, 2012 (2015)
Eurasian Integration: The History
History in brief
December 9, 2010
Declaration on the
Establishment of the Single
Economic Space of Belarus,
Kazakhstan and the Russian
Federation
Moving towards the establishment of the Eurasian
Economic Union in order to achieve balanced, mutually
reinforcing and beneficial cooperation with other
countries, international economic unions and EU with a
view to create a single economic space
November 18, 2011
Declaration on Eurasian
Economic Integration
Desire to complete by January 1, 2015 codification of
international Treaties that make up the regulatory legal
framework of the Customs Union and Single economic
union, thus laying groundwork for the future Eurasian
Economic Union.
March 19, 2012
Declaration by the three
Presidents
Reaffirming commitment to establish the Eurasian
Economic Union by 2015

The impact of WTO
• The World Trade Organization (WTO) is
an organization that intends to supervise and
liberalize international trade among the
participating countries.
• Founded: Jan, 1995
WTO members from Post-Soviet Countries:
Georgia – 2000, Ukraine – 2008, Russia - 2012
• Different tariff regulations of Customs Union
and WTO, leads to implications for the
harmonization of tariffs among the EAU
member-states.
The impact of WTO
As a sample: By joining to the Customs Union,
the Ukraine has to compensate the losses
incurred by the other WTO members, an
amount estimated at USD 1.9 billion.
Energy dependency as a means of
Integration
But :
Since 1st of January 2012, gas price for Belarus lowered from USD 244
to USD 164 per 1000 cubic meters which led to USD 2, 0.000.000
(billion) annual benefit for Belarus. In return, Belarus sold the shares
of state-owned oil company Beltansgaz corporation for 2.5 billion to
the Gazprom where Russia gained control over 80% of gas network of
Europe through the Ukraine.

Energy dependency as a means of
Integration
All energy pipelines from Russia to Europe:
Druzhba pipeline network takes Russian oil through Belarus to Poland and Germany in the north
and in the south through Ukraine to Central Europe and the Balkans, as well as to Italy.
Yamal pipeline carries natural gas through the Belarus to Poland & Germany.
South Stream (through Black Sea) and Nord Stream (through Baltic Sea) pipelines

Military dimensions
Collective Security Treaty Organization –
CSTO
The Eurasian Union member – states co-ordinates their
military and security services through the CSTO.
• Founded : 7th October, 2002
• Member-states:
• Armenia, Belarus,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Russia, Tajikistan
• Annual Budget: 5.414.620.000 USD

Rapid Reaction Forces
Founded by the CSTO member states on 4th February, 2009.
Based on 2 components:
- Army component for resolution of armed and border conflicts
- Special purpose troops for combating with terrorism and drug
trafficking ;
Russian investment in Military
• The Russian military bases in the Asia:
- 3 military bases in Abkhazia
- 1 military base in South Ossetia
- Ground forces in Transnistra, Moldova
- Infantry division in Tajikistan
- Naval base in Sevastopol, the Ukraine
- Also, some forces in Armenia, Kyrgyzstan & Tajikistan
The intended investment in the military:
Allocation in the amount of USD 800 billion for reform and rearm of the
Russian troops;
Increasment the amount of Airborne from 7500 – 20.000 (by 2017)

What does Eurasian Union
integration project stands for ?
Eurasian Union Integration project is deemed for:
- Creating an independent pole in the perceived global multipolar system ;
- To eliminate the European expansion towards the Eastern Europe;
- To regain co-equal global leadership;
- Meet the Chinese economic challenges, primarily in Central Asia;
- Oppose the Islamist expansion into the Central Asia, North Caucasus, Siberia,
the Urals and Volga region;
- To solid the energy dependency policy of the Europe by monopolizing the
regional resources and etc. ;
Conclusion
• To sum up all the above, we could make the following
outcomes:
- Russia’s new idea to create the Eurasian Economic Union is considered to
offer post - soviet states (besides, Baltic states) a “forced alternative” of the
European Union which promises less successes.
- Unlike, the European Union, Eurasian Economic Union offers restricted
sovereignty of member-states which cause disblief for such integration.
- Russian ruled Collective Security Treaty Organization will be less effective in
Asia, unless China is not a member of this security organization.
- Generally, Russian investment in military serves for eradicating NATO
influence to the Asia, as well as keeping the status – quo of “frozen”
conflicts of the region.
